High schoolers will learn how to properly record coaching film at free training session hosted by the Football Film Federation at the Radisson Blu on Sunday.

The Football Film Federation is offering high schoolers free entry to a training session in which they'll use the latest video technology to learn the proper techniques for filming games and practices. The program's goal is to improve the quality of the film coaches use on the sidelines in games and at practices, and to show there's a career path in the field. Photo by Alex Kormann, Star Tribune
